Default $27 QQ , A-high checked flop

Hi,

PokerStars Tournament, Big Blind is t30 (9 handed) Converter on pregopoker.com

Hero (t1500)
UTG+1 (t1400)
MP1 (t1350)
MP2 (t1360)
MP3 (t1500)
CO (t1980)
Button (t1470)
SB (t1440)
BB (t1500)

Preflop: Hero is in UTG with Q[img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img] Q[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]
<font color="red">Hero raises to t90</font>, <font color="gray">UTG+1 folds</font>, <font color="gray">MP1 folds</font>, <font color="gray">MP2 folds</font>, <font color="gray">MP3 folds</font>, <font color="gray">CO folds</font>, <font color="gray">Button folds</font>, SB calls t75, <font color="gray">BB folds</font>

Flop: (t210) 6[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] A[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] 7[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] (2 players)
SB checks, Hero checks

Turn: (t210) 8[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] (2 players)
<font color="red">SB bets t120</font>, Hero calls t120

River: (t450) 5[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] (2 players)
<font color="red">SB bets t210</font>, <font color="gray">Hero folds</font>

Vilain is unknown.

Flush possible, Str8 possible (very easily) and Ace high.
Its two things:
1)The perfect spot to bluff against the kind of hand you have.
2)A very unlikely hand for you to win.
Now the pot is 450. Is this a bluff 40% of the time ? I think its less than that. For me the fold is good.

I'd let this go on the river. Every draw known to man just got there and alot of weak aces make 2 pair at some point in this hand and probably play this way. I like the turn call, but I'd get away here.

Not c-betting makes it easy for villain and hard for you.

If you raised AK/AQ no-heart would you check this Flop?

If your UTG range is 99+, AQ+ (or similar) you've either got Top Pair or a hand that was excellent preflop but now vulnerable to the overcard. And by not betting the drawy Flop, from Villain's perspective it's easy to narrow your range even further.

With no read I c-bet.
